CVE-2021-33886
Last modified
CVE-2021-33886 is a high-severity vulnerability rated 8.8/10 on the CVSS scale. An improper sanitization of input vulnerability in B. Braun SpaceCom2 prior to 012U000062 allows a remote unauthenticated attacker to gain user-level command-line access by passing a raw external string straight through to printf statements. EPSS estimates a 0.83% chance of exploitation in the next 30 days.
Description
An improper sanitization of input vulnerability in B. Braun SpaceCom2 prior to 012U000062 allows a remote unauthenticated attacker to gain user-level command-line access by passing a raw external string straight through to printf statements. The attacker is required to be on the same network as the device.
